What Does Addiction Treatment Look Like in Highfield, MD?

Alcoholism recovery necessitates a total change of one's lifestyle and perceptions. Drug and alcohol addiction is a debilitating disease that changes the mind as well as the body. It can take weeks or even months of intensive substance abuse treatment to totally address the hidden causes of substance abuse addiction. Learning stress management, healthy boundaries, and coping skills will significantly increase the likelihood of permanent sobriety. Until we address the underlying reasons for chemical dependency, there is little hope for continuing sobriety. Substance abuse addiction can be co-occurring with mental health disorders, trauma, or behavioral issues. Drug abuse rehab starts by treating the physical body to ensure that substances are removed. After drugs and alcohol are out of the body, therapists begin treating the brain.

Inpatient or Outpatient Treatment?

The most important difference between inpatient and outpatient treatment is that clients in inpatient care live at a treatment facility full time, while clients in outpatient care live off-site at home or in sober living housing. However, there are additional key differences between inpatient and outpatient care, including:

  • Inpatient treatment is able to provide greater support during withdrawal;
  • Outpatient treatment can be scheduled around a person’s existing responsibilities;
  • Inpatient treatment provides around-the-clock care;
  • Outpatient treatment is often more affordable;
  • Inpatient treatment is more likely to prevent a return to use during treatment;

How Long Will Addiction Treatment Take in Highfield, MD?

If you have the opportunity to go to a longer term substance abuse treatment you should certainly take that opportunity. These drug abuse treatments assist you with drug and alcohol addiction on a deeply engrained level and help a person to fully change their way of life. These longer term programs have been shown to have highest success rates. In pop culture, rehab is usually depicted as a 30 day program. Realistically, there are many different programs that last a different amount of time. These longer term substance abuse treatments usually consist of medical detox, followed by inpatient treatment, intensive outpatient treatment, followed by outpatient treatment usually combined with a sober living situation. Some rehabs are 30 days, but many last months longer. Some treatments have a duration of six months to a year in length.
